**Building Access: Night Shift (Support Team)**

Welcome aboard! If you're on the overnight support rota at Thistledown Plaza, the main doors lock at 20:00, so you'll be coming in through the east side entrance by the courtyard. Tap your badge on the reader first — if it flashes amber, don't panic, that just means the night lockdown is active. Give it a second, then use the keypad. Always make sure the door clicks shut behind you. The keypad code for night access is below.

turnstile pass: bdg-NG-3

## Formula sandbox tuning

User-supplied formulas in Gridmoor execute inside a restricted interpreter with hard ceilings on time, memory, and call depth. Reviewers should confirm any change to these ceilings is justified in the PR description, since raising them widens the abuse surface. Defaults were chosen from production traces. The current limits are as follows.

limits module of tafog-fawip:
WEIGHTS = {
    "julix": 57,
    "lamys": 992,
    "kasvan": 209,
    "quenok": 750,
    "alddor": 259,
    "oliath": 1009,
    "wenix": 815,
}

MINUTES — Management Meeting, Sales Leads

Present: Dovan, Keric, Lusa. Topic: revised commission scheme.

Decisions: Base rate drops to 4%; accelerator kicks in at 110% of quota, rising to 9%. Multi-year Harrowfield contracts earn a 1.5x multiplier. Clawbacks apply to cancellations within 90 days. Draws discontinued after Q2. Keric to circulate calculator sheet by Monday. Lusa to handle objections at the regional call. Effective first of next quarter. No exceptions without Dovan's sign-off. Context for leadership follows below.

board note of kageg-bahof: The renewal with Holwynax Holdings closes at $2 million a year, 5 percent below the last contract. Project Ulaath slips by two quarters because of the supplier delay.

TURN-208: Gatevale turnstile counters at the Merrow Field pilot double-count when a rotation reverses mid-cycle. Attendance totals drift roughly 2% high per event. The debounce window fix is implemented, reviewed by Ilsa, and soak-tested across two simulated match days without drift. Ready for your cut; the candidate build is identified below.

trace token, tagag-tafog: htk6_5ed18c